WebJul 1, 2016 · The angle of the stifle joint for all measurements was defined as the angle formed by the longitudinal axis of the femur and the longitudinal axis of the tibia as previously described. 1,14 The longitudinal axis of the femur was defined as the line connecting the greater trochanter to the center of the lateral condyle, in the epicondylar … WebGoniometry is inevitable in the inspection of joints and surrounding soft tissue [4]. For several joints such as carpus, tarsus, stifle, elbow, shoulder and hip joints are mainly assessed by goniometry in canine orthopedics, to evaluate joint disease and treatment effectiveness [1, 5, 9].
